Ellen Mandler OF BLESSED MEMORY

Ellen Mandler liked to refer to herself as a “professional volunteer.” She took her responsibilities seriously and spent numerous hours organizing, attending meetings and raising money for various Jewish organizations. Ellen was deeply committed to Jewish causes. The majority of her time was spent first with Hadassah and later with the Greater Miami Jewish Federation, but she was also active in American Jewish
